First edition, hardback in laminate boards. Two volumes on one (you flip the book over for the other volume). 24 × 17.5cm, 448pp. Bulgarian text.

A celebration of the Bulgarian poet, translator, and journalist Geo Milev who was executed in the aftermath of the St Nedelya Church bombing in 1925. He had been arrested as he was a member of the Bulgarian Communist Party. Volume one contains poetry, translations, essays, criticism, journalism, letters, whilst volume two contains his sketches, drawings etc.
